OUR FIRST MEETING
During our first meeting I try to complete an initial assessment to understand what has brought you to therapy and what has happened to you. It is not always possible to complete the assessment phase in our first session; it may take a few sessions. However, following the initial assessment, we can then agree to continue our work together and I will provide a professional opinion as to how best to move forward. I will also send you my working agreement and privacy statement for you to sign.
As everyone’s difficulties are unique, the length of therapy can vary greatly. I try to offer a flexible approach and where funding is limited we can explore this and adapt the therapy accordingly.
The initial session or sessions are an opportunity for you to see if working with me feels safe and is right for you. Having a ‘good connection’ is important for the therapy to progress.
FURTHER INFORMATION
I work with children and their families from the age of 10.
My sessions are by appointment only and arranged in advance on a weekly basis on the same day and time.
If you are late, we will still have to finish at the allotted time.
Because of the nature of psychotherapy, it is not possible to allocate appointments on an ad hoc basis.
Full fee is charged for missed sessions, unless in exceptional circumstances such as hospitalisation.
